You've selected a station type that has solar sensors, but it looks like your station isn't the type that has those. The memory layout is different, hence the garbage data.

Having a solar charger isn't the same as having solar sensors, and it looks very much from what I can see that yours doesn't have solar sensors. Can you display Light and UV values on the console? The correct station type setting for a station without solar sensors is "Fine Offset (WH1080 etc)".

I've also noticed that you're allowing your PC to suspend while Cumulus is running; this will cause gaps in your data once you do have it set up correctly.

When did you change the setting? If you've only just done it, then some things like rain total and wind run for today will still be affected by the old settings. To zero today's wind run, you need to edit today.ini, with Cumulus stopped. You can set today's rain total from the editor on the edit menu. If you only edit the records, and the current values are still high, the records will immediately get overwritten by the current value.

Note that all the time you've been running with the wrong station type selected, a lot of your readings will be invalid anyway, not just the ones which are clearly too high.
